Story so far
The Punjab government has given its approval to hold the Basant festival. After an initial in-principle agreement, the dates have now been formally announced for the last week of January 2027. Authorities are developing a safety plan which includes restricting kite-flying to designated areas and forming a committee to regulate the price of kites and strings.
